Pros and Cons of Galleries in Vancouver

Hosting an exhibition in Vancouver? Keep these pros and cons in mind throughout the planning process.

Advantages

  • Artsy vibe
    Take a wander around Vancouver and you’ll immediately notice that there’s a real artistic, eclectic feel in some neighborhoods — so it’s a place where many artists will feel right at home.

  • Good food
    There’s an increasingly diverse restaurant scene on offer in Vancouver, so you shouldn’t have any trouble sourcing quality cuisine for your event.

  • Wide range of options
    It may not be the biggest city going around, but Vancouver combines small-town charm with all the amenities you’d expect in a big city. This means there’s plenty of options to choose from when planning a gallery opening.

  • Growing city
    As Vancouver’s population continues to grow, the size of the potential audience to attend your exhibition (and hopefully buy an artwork piece or two) is increasing.

  • Friendly atmosphere
    Vancouver has a well-earned reputation as being a much friendlier and more welcoming destination than many larger cities. So if you’re looking for somewhere you can showcase your work in a supportive environment, you’re in the right place.

Disadvantages

  • Traffic
    Traffic congestion can be a problem when traveling to or around Vancouver, so keep ease of access in mind when choosing a Vancouver gallery space.

  • Rain
    It rains in Vancouver more than 160 days a year. While all that precipitation ensures that the area is naturally beautiful, it can be quite difficult to entice people out to a gallery opening on a cold, wet night.

  • Increasingly expensive
    The cost of living in Vancouver is on the rise, so organizing an art exhibition in the city might cost more than you expect.

  • Crime
    Crime can be an issue in some areas of the city, so be sure to choose a Vancouver gallery space in a safe neighborhood.

  • Limited public transport
    The public transport system in Vancouver is quite limited, so remember to consider how attendees will get to and from your venue when choosing a gallery space.

Famous Locations in Vancouver

  • Fort Vancouver National Historic Site
    The site of one of the earliest permanent settlements on this side of the Rocky Mountains, the 190-plus-acre Fort Vancouver is a must-see for any history buff. It sits on the north bank of the mighty Columbia River and has a history as a fur trading post as well as a military barracks.

  • Vancouver Lake Regional Park
    If you’re keen to enjoy some outdoor recreation, make sure you check out what this 190-acre regional park has to offer. Stretching along 2.5 miles of the lake’s western shoreline, it’s a popular spot for kayaking, canoeing, and other watersports.

  • Esther Short Park
    The oldest public square in Washington and Vancouver’s most-loved park, Esther Short Park. Whether you’re letting the kids enjoy the awesome playground or just soaking up some sunshine, there’s much to enjoy here.
